| Summary: | This textbook provides definitive coverage of the effects of exercise on physiological systems in the context of the most recent research. Discusses relevant issues such as the role exercise plays in fighting the global pandemic of sedentary disease among all age groups including obesity, diabetes, and metabolic syndrome. Examples are integrated throughout the textbook linking principles of exercise physiology to strategies that can be used in real-life client situations. |
